Job Description
Nashua Community College is seeking qualified individuals who are interested in adjunct teaching at the College on a course-by-course basis; strong academic background is required. Adjunct appointments are temporary, for a specified contract period and may require in classroom or online instruction. We have a need for instructors for the following course(s) in our
Aviation Department:
Freshmen Class:
General Aviation Maintenance Topics ( Classes 1-2 days a week (6-7 hours), 16 weeks- Full Term)Seniors:
Powerplant Topics (Classes 1-2 Day a week (7-8 hours), 16 weeks- Full Term)Evening Class:
Advanced Airframe Topics (Classes 1-2 Days a week 4-10pm, or Saturdays 8am-noon)Minimum Qualifications:
Education:
Associate's degree from a regionally accredited college or technical school with major study aviation technology, education, business administration, engineering or related field.Experience:
Six (6) years of teaching experience in the aviation technology field or six (6) years of military or FAA experience in Air Traffic Control.License/Certification:
FAA or Military Air Traffic Control certificationPreferred Qualifications/Certifications:
FAA instructor experience, Recent Air Traffic Control experience, Adjunct Teaching experience. The salary range for this position is $825-$975 per contact hour. The rate will be determined by the appointed adjunct faculty rank, which is based on education and industry and/or teaching experience. CCSNH has established employer status within the New England states (Maine, New Hampshire, Vermont, Massachusetts, Connecticut, and Rhode Island). In compliance with CCSNH policies and state regulations, eligibility for employment within CCSNH and its institutions requires residency within a New England state.Application Process:
